    Gary Valentine, a series regular on the CBS sitcom "The King of Queens," got his start in the world of stand-up comedy. For 13 years, he traveled the country refining his comedic routine by performing at comedy clubs and festivals. He starred in his own special on Comedy Central, and has performed stand-up on The Tonight Show.

    Gary Valentine, who became a series regular on The King of Queens in 2001, got his start in the world of stand-up comedy. For 13 years, he traveled the country refining his comedic routine by performing at comedy clubs and festivals. After headlining at the Montreal Comedy Festival, he moved to Los Angeles, where he appeared on The Late Late Show on CBS, and The Tonight Show with Jay Leno.

    Valentine's television credits also include starring in his own half-hour comedy special on Comedy Central and co-hosting FX's The X Show. Valentine was also recently seen in the film I Now Pronounce You Chuck and Larry.
